Advanced Betting Strategies for Success

To maximize winning potential, players can adopt advanced betting strategies. Techniques such as pot betting, the continuation bet, and value betting allow players to optimize their profit margins. Additionally, learning about odds and probability can enhance decision-making processes. For instance, understanding the concept of Expected Value (EV) can help players make tactical adjustments based on their opponents’ behavior and patterns.

Bankroll Management Techniques

Proper bankroll management is a cornerstone of successful gambling. Players should establish a budget that delineates how much they are willing to risk in any given session and stick to it. Strategies such as setting loss limits, determining session lengths, and adjusting bet sizes based on bankroll fluctuations can help mitigate risks and extend playtime. It is vital to go into a game prepared and emotionally detached from outcomes—after all, g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income.

Recognizing Problem Gambling Signs

Identifying the signs of problem gambling can prevent more severe issues from developing. Key indicators include gambling to escape negative emotions, lying about gambling habits, and neglecting personal or professional responsibilities. Awareness of these signs is the first step toward seeking help.

Tools for Safe Gambling

Many online platforms provide tools and resources to promote responsible gambling. Options such as deposit limits, time-out periods, and self-exclusion programs can be invaluable in fostering a safe gambling environment. Always know your limits and use these tools proactively.

Strategies for Staying Within Limits

Establishing personal guidelines for play can directly influence the gambling experience. Setting strict budgets and timelines for sessions, as well as refraining from chasing losses, can help players remain in control and enjoy their time at the tables without the pressure of spiraling finances.
